Show BARKER HOME DESTROYED BY FIRE THURS, A home, barn and granary, belonging be-longing to Mrs. John Barker on the highway south of this city, was practically demolished by fire last Thursday afternoon. A strong wind swept the blaze which began on the north side of the barn, to the granary and then to the house, before firemen reached the scene. The fire had a good start before being detected. The five department succeeded in saving a garage, undei-whieh was a fruit room, also some furniture and clothing from the home. Damage was estimated at approximately ap-proximately $1500 with little or no insurance according to Fire Chief Roy Despain. |
